Regular .NET Developer
Form of cooperation: freelance project-specific B2B contract from May to mid-August, with the possibility of extension based on project needs and performance.
Tech stack:
.NET, Cloud (Azure), PostgreSQL
Requirements:
2+ years of commercial experience delivering backend systems in C#/.NET, including PostgreSQL and REST API development
Experience deploying and working with applications on Azure
Ability to communicate effectively with clients and team members to understand technical requirements
Good sense of ownership and accountability for assigned tasks and features
Basic understanding of software architecture and ability to work across different system components (backend, frontend, databases)
Solid understanding of software development best practices, code quality standards, and clean code principles
Good communication skills for collaboration with technical and non-technical team members
Nice to have
Azure certifications (e.g., Azure Developer Associate)
Experience working with IoT software solutions
Project description:
We are building an Installation Management System – a strategic platform to digitalize installation and servicing processes for metering devices across the organization. The solution will replace paper-based workflows with a fully integrated web and mobile system, becoming the single source of truth for device and structural data while significantly improving operational efficiency.
Main responsibilities:
Design, build, and maintain backend software using C#/.NET
Take ownership of assigned features and modules from development through deployment and maintenance
Collaborate on software architecture decisions and ensure proper integration across system components (mobile, backend, frontend, databases)
Design and deliver robust APIs for frontend and mobile consumption
Persist, query, and optimize operational data stored in PostgreSQL
Ensure production readiness of delivered features, including monitoring, logging, and performance considerations
Collaborate closely with .NET Lead, but also with Mobile, UX, Frontend, QA, and DevOps teams
Follow software development best practices, code quality standards, and maintainable code
Participate in code reviews and share knowledge with team members
- Department
- Software Delivery
- Role
- Software Engineer
- Locations
- Poland (PL)
- Remote status
- Fully Remote
- Hourly salary
- PLN80 - PLN110
- Employment type
- Contract
- Skills
- .NET
- Experience
- Regular
About Spyrosoft
Spyrosoft is an authentic, cutting-edge software engineering company, established in 2016. In 2021 and 2022, we were among the fastest growing technology companies in Europe, according to the Financial Times. We were founded by a group of tech experts with established backgrounds in software engineering, who created an ‘engineer-to-engineer’ workplace, powered by enthusiasm, fairness and authentic relationships. Having a unique offering, which bridge the gap between technology and business, we specialise in technology solutions for industry 4.0, automotive, geospatial, healthcare & life sciences, employee experience & education and financial services industries.